Muhannad Ahmed Abu Radeah Assiri (Arabic: مهند أحمد أبو رديه عسيري; born 14 October 1986) is a Saudi Arabian former professional footballer who plays as a forward.[2]
In May 2018, he was named in Saudi Arabia’s preliminary squad for the 2018 FIFA World Cup in Russia.[3]
On 7 August 2021, Assiri announced his retirement from football.[4]
